What Are the Dimensions of a Lap Blanket?

The dimensions of a lap blanket aren't standardized like, say, a twin-sized bedsheet. There's a lot of variability depending on the manufacturer, the style, and the intended use. However, we can give you a general idea and explore some common variations.

Generally, you can expect a lap blanket to fall within a range designed for comfortable use on your lap and possibly your legs. Think of it as a smaller, cozier version of a throw blanket.

Typical Dimensions:

Most lap blankets fall within the range of 40-50 inches wide by 50-60 inches long. This allows for adequate coverage while remaining manageable and portable. Smaller sizes are certainly available, especially for children or for use in cars, while larger ones might be marketed as "oversized lap blankets" or even border on the size of a throw blanket.

What Factors Influence Lap Blanket Size?

Several factors influence the final dimensions of a lap blanket:

  • Material: Bulky materials like chunky knits or fleece will naturally create a more substantial and potentially larger-feeling blanket, even if the measurements are similar to a thinner material.
  • Manufacturer: Different brands have different design philosophies. Some prioritize larger sizes for maximum coverage, while others may opt for more compact designs for better portability.
  • Intended Use: A lap blanket for a child will be smaller than one intended for an adult. A travel lap blanket might be even smaller and more compact to easily fit in luggage.
  • Style: Some lap blankets are square, while others are rectangular. This will impact the overall dimensions and how the blanket drapes.

What are the dimensions of a baby lap blanket?

Baby lap blankets are generally smaller than adult lap blankets, typically ranging from 25-35 inches square or a similar rectangular shape. However, these dimensions can also vary.
